Richard M. "Dick" Aric

October 1, 1930 ~ December 10, 2017 (age 87) 87 Years Old


 87, of Sun Rise, FL, formerly of Queen St., Cranston, passed away on Sunday, December 10, 2017.  He was the beloved husband of the late Josephine T. (Morrocco) Aric.  Born in Philadelphia, PA, he was the son of the late Marion P. and Mary E. (Hess) Aric.

Dick was the owner of the former Aric Tile Company and was a ship fitter at General Dynamics Electric Boat in North Kingstown before retiring.  He was a U.S. Navy Korean War veteran; and past Commander and Chief of American Legion Post #77, Providence.
